Как распределить одиночные обои по двум мониторам?


37

У меня установлен двойной монитор в Ubuntu 11.10. Я хочу иметь одинаковые обои на обоих мониторах. Как мне это сделать?


Могу заметить, что, хотя азот, кажется, не меняет обои машин nvidia, у него есть крутой побочный эффект, который все же может сделать его стоящим. Если изменения через азот происходят позже, чем ваши изменения в стандартном менеджере рабочего стола Ubuntu, изображения будут отображаться на заднем плане терминалов, если их фон установлен прозрачным. Таким образом, у вас есть «скрытые» обои.

1
Системные настройки> внешний вид - «Размах» вместо «зум», и большинство изображений придется масштабировать, чтобы увеличить, а затем обрезать до соотношения сторон, которое будет намного шире, если мониторы будут размещены рядом.
Васс

Ответы:


19

Для начала вам понадобятся обои, достаточно большие для обоих мониторов. Вы можете сделать один с gimp или загрузить один. В качестве альтернативы вы можете использовать отдельное изображение для каждого монитора.

Затем вы можете установить удобное небольшое приложение, азот

sudo apt-get install nitrogen

Затем вы запускаете азот с указанием пути к каталогу с вашими изображениями.

nitrogen ~/Pictures

И выберите изображение. В нижней части азота выберите «автоматический» и «полный экран» в качестве параметров. альтернативно вы можете использовать азот, чтобы установить отдельное изображение на каждом экране, вплоть до вас (вид зависит от ваших фоновых изображений).

азот


5
Ага. Я загрузил его и запустил. Однако, когда я нажимаю «Применить», ничего не происходит. У меня установлена ​​видеокарта Nvidia, что означает использование настроек Nvidia X Server.
MegaBubbletea

Странно, азот работает с моей картой nvidia.
Пантера

Перезагрузка ПК еще не работает. Даже пробовал использовать рут доступ. Не повезло тоже.
MegaBubbletea

2
Азот работает после этой настройки: askubuntu.com/a/96979/118
2012 г.,

2
Этот ответ не работает для меня на Ubuntu 16.04. Когда я нажимаю «Применить», ничего не происходит, и настройка не помогает. Я использую «плазму».
Карло Вуд

52

при использовании гнома-оболочки, в TWEAK инструмента под столом есть вариант , чтобы иметь изображение , Span рабочий стола. Это заставляет его проходить через оба монитора (или все).

Азот не нужен

Unity также имеет такую ​​же опцию, как показано ниже:

Варианты внешнего вида - размах


4
+1 Это самый простой ответ. Для двух мониторов 1080p просто обрежьте изображение до 3840x1080, выберите его, затем выберите «span» в настройках.
Том Броссман

2
Параметры изменились с момента первоначального вопроса. В 2011 году на момент вопроса не было опциона «Спан».
Пантера

5
Ничего из этого даже не существует в Ubuntu 18.04.
aalaap

Работает и для мяты. Лучшее изображение в двух мониторах с разрешением 1920x1080 с изображением размером 3840x1080
sgiri

3
@aalaap Для Ubuntu 18.04 вам необходимо установить gnome-tweaksинструмент вручную. Когда вы запустите его, в разделе «Внешний вид» вы найдете опцию, чтобы охватить рабочий стол и заблокировать обои экрана.
likeitlikeit

15

Азотный ответ работает, но необходим еще один твик. Запустите Расширенные настройки в Gnome Tweak Tool, перейдите в раздел « Рабочий стол » и выберите « Отключить управление рабочим столом файлового менеджера» . Затем будут отображаться обои, установленные с помощью азота.

Если у вас нет Gnome Tweak Tool, вы можете использовать эту команду вместо этого. Это также более простое решение:

gsettings set org.gnome.desktop.background show-desktop-icons false

Однако есть сильный недостаток. Все значки исчезают с рабочего стола, и контекстное меню не может быть вызвано. Если вам не нужны значки на рабочем столе, это решение может быть полезно для вас.


Спасибо за ваш ответ. Хотя это хорошее решение, я все еще хочу значки на рабочем столе. Я надеюсь, что Ubuntu будет полностью поддерживать обои с несколькими мониторами лучше в будущих версиях.
MegaBubbletea

Как уже упоминалось @topr, Nitrogen не предоставит вам возможность выбора значков на рабочем столе и контекстных меню. Гораздо лучшим вариантом является объединение ваших изображений в один файл и использование опции «охватывать несколько мониторов». Вы можете объединить изображения с ImageMagick, используяconvert +append -gravity south wallpaper*.jpg combined_wallpaper.jpg
Gui Ambros

12

Похоже, я не могу добавить комментарий к ответу из-за моей низкой репутации (lolz), так что это должно быть в ответе @ topr.

Я являюсь автором Nitrogen, и там есть код, чтобы обнаружить рабочий стол гнома и правильно его настроить, чтобы вам не нужно было вносить это изменение, но, похоже, он не работает на современном Ubuntus. Я буду расследовать.

Проблема: https://github.com/l3ib/nitrogen/issues/16


использование gnome-tweak-tool решило эту проблему ... см. здесь: askubuntu.com/questions/390367/…
m13r

2

Взгляните на эту ссылку: http://www.virtual-nexus-inc.com/news/2011/09/21/ubuntu-11-04-dual-monitor-backgrounds-are-easy-with-shotwell/

Вы можете использовать Shotwell, чтобы изменить размер изображения в качестве разрешения комбинированного монитора, а затем установить его в качестве фона, используя средство просмотра изображений Ubuntu по умолчанию.


2

Для Ubuntu 16.04 и более поздних версий, которые не предлагают опцию «span» в настройках или вообще не имеют опций, вы можете запустить следующую команду для принудительной установки диапазона:

gsettings set org.gnome.desktop.background picture-options spanned

Эффект мгновенный.

Я пробовал это с 18.04, но похоже, что он должен работать с 16.04 и выше.

Источник

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.